Report: Original Plans For Bad Bunny At WWE Backlash Revealed

A singles match was not the original plan

Rap sensation Bad Bunny will take on Damian Priest in a San Juan Street Fight at Backlash tomorrow, in what will be both the Grammy winner's first singles match and first match in his home country. 

According to a new report, WWE had different plans for Bad Bunny originally. 

Fightful Select noted that around WrestleMania time the idea was to have him team up with Rey Mysterio against The Judgment Day duo of Priest and Dominik Mysterio. Things were moving in that direction when plans changed to a singles match instead. 

WWE made the switch when both they and Bad Bunny were deemed to have felt confident with the rapper's ability to have a good singles match. 

Fightful added that the original idea was for Bad Bunny to pin Dominik in the proposed tag match. Both Mysterios will be in Puerto Rico for the premium live event and could still play a part in the match, given the Street Fight rules. 

A recent report suggested that both Priest and Bad Bunny were pushing to main event Backlash.
